Linux文件目录 --- mkdir命令,创建目录,多级目录,设置目录权限

五、mkdir命令

mkdir 命令用于创建一个或多个目录。它可以创建新的目录结构,有助于文件的组织和管理,下面是该命令的语法以及常用的选项参数。

mkdir [选项] 目录名称

|----|-------------|
| 选项 | 作用 |
| -m | 设置新创建目录权限 |
| -p | 循环建立目录 |
| -v | 创建目录时显示详细信息 |

1.创建单个目录

执行下行代码,会在当前目录下新增一个目录。

[root@fnd_LN ~]# mkdir mulu01 #可以不添加任何选项

2.创建多个目录

在当前目录下一次性创建三个目录。

[root@fnd_LN ~]# mkdir mu01 mu02 mu03 #中间使用空格隔开

3.设置目录权限

新建一个目录并把权限设为777,给所有者、所属组、其他用户等都给予可读可写可执行的权限。

[root@fnd_LN ~]# mkdir -m 777 mu01

drwxrwxrwx. 2 root root 6 12月 25 09:22 mu01

4.循环目录

循环创建目录,若当前目录下没有"01,02,03"目录,则会先创建01目录再在01目录里面创建02目录,循环直至创建04目录。

[root@fnd_LN ~]# mkdir -p 01/02/03/04

5.详细信息

创建目录时添加"-v"选择,在创建成功后会弹出" mkdir: 已创建目录 "名称" ",不需要再使用ls命令来查看目录是否创建成功。

[root@fnd_LN 01]# mkdir -v 033

mkdir: 已创建目录 "033"

相关推荐
Neil Parker3 分钟前
Linux安装zookeeper
linux·zookeeper·debian
千航@abc4 小时前
vim多文件操作如何同屏开多个文件
linux·编辑器·vim
pianmian16 小时前
使用where子句筛选记录
java·服务器·数据库
Pakho love7 小时前
Linux:文件与fd(被打开的文件)
android·linux·c语言·c++
Tangcan-7 小时前
Linux中基础开发工具(yum,vim,gcc/g++,git,gdb/cgdb)
linux·git·vim
千航@abc7 小时前
vim交换文件的作用
linux·编辑器·vim
抹茶咖啡10 小时前
IT运维的365天--025 H3C交换机用NTP同步正确的时间
运维·网络
流星白龙10 小时前
【Linux】使用管道实现一个简易版本的进程池
linux·运维·服务器
自信不孤单11 小时前
Linux线程安全
linux·多线程·条件变量·线程安全·同步··互斥
7yewh11 小时前
嵌入式知识点总结 Linux驱动 (七)-Linux驱动常用函数 uboot命令 bootcmd bootargs get_part env_get
linux·arm开发·驱动开发·mcu·物联网·硬件工程